Abstract
Provided are methods of preparing filtration media in which a microporous layer is coated on a temporary carrier substrate and a porous substrate is then laminated to the microporous layer, after or prior to removing the temporary carrier substrate from the microporous layer. Preferably, the microporous layer comprises one or more microporous xerogel layers. Also provided are filtration media prepared by such methods.

exact text as granted — not AI-modified1 . Filtration media comprising a microporous layer, wherein said filtration media is prepared according to a method comprising the steps of:
(a) coating a microporous layer on a temporary carrier substrate to form a microporous layer assembly, wherein said microporous layer has a first surface in contact with said temporary carrier substrate and has a second surface on the side opposite from said temporary carrier substrate; (b) laminating said microporous layer assembly on the side opposite from said temporary carrier substrate to a porous substrate to form a porous substrate/microporous layer assembly; (c) removing said temporary carrier substrate from said first surface of said microporous layer.
2 . The filtration media of claim 1 , wherein said microporous layer comprises one or more microporous xerogel layers formed by drying a liquid metal oxide sol to form a xerogel layer of a solid metal oxide gel matrix with pores which are interconnected in a continuous fashion from one outermost surface of said xerogel layer through to the other outermost surface of said xerogel layer.
3 . The filtration media of claim 1 , wherein said microporous layer comprises one or more microporous metal oxide xerogel layers, wherein said microporous metal oxide xerogel layers are continuous xerogel coating layers with said metal oxides in a continuous structure in said xerogel coating layers.
4 . The filtration media of claim 2 , wherein at least one of said one or more microporous xerogel layers comprises a material selected from the group consisting of pseudo-boehmites, zirconium oxides, titanium oxides, aluminum oxides, silicon oxides, and tin oxides.
5 . The filtration media of claim 2 , wherein said liquid metal oxide sol comprises a binder selected from the group consisting of organic polymer binders and inorganic binders.
6 . The filtration media of claim 3 , wherein at least one of said one or more microporous metal oxide xerogel layers comprises a material selected from the group consisting of pseudo-boehmites, zirconium oxides, titanium oxides, aluminum oxides, silicon oxides, and tin oxides.
7 . The filtration media of claim 3 , wherein at least one of said one or more microporous metal oxide xerogel layers comprises a binder selected from the group consisting of organic polymer binders and inorganic binders.
8 . The filtration media of claim 1 , wherein said microporous layer comprises a discontinuous layer that is not a xerogel coating layer and has discontinuities of solid pigment particles that are separated from each other in the structure of said discontinuous layer.
9 . The filtration media of claim 8 , wherein said discontinuous layer comprises a binder selected from the group consisting of organic polymer binders and inorganic binders.
10 . The filtration media of claim 1 , wherein said temporary carrier substrate is a flexible web substrate.
11 . The filtration media of claim 10 , wherein said flexible web substrate is selected from the group consisting of papers, polymeric films, and metals.
12 . The filtration media of claim 10 , wherein said flexible web substrate is surface treated with a release agent.
